码迷,mamicode.com
首页 > 系统相关
基于Linux的智能家居的设计(1)
写在前面:做了半年的毕业设计,找到的工作与这个完全无关,发现自己现在有写不甘心,但是我还是在关注这方面的发展,自己的摸索和前人的帮助我完成了智能家居的一部分,希望这个能够给一些初学者 能够一些便利,毕竟技术是一个开放的,不属于某一个人的。 摘要 本课题主要目的是设计和实现一个基于Linux开发平台的智能家居系统。本系统主要使用PVC板做成的家居模型。本系统硬件使用基于ARM架构的samsu...
分类:系统相关   时间:2015-07-24 22:40:12    阅读次数:258
基于Linux的智能家居的设计(2)
1  系统总体设计方案 智能家居系统的是一个实时查询家庭的温湿度、照明控制、自动控制的设定,集家庭娱乐、智能安防为一体,大量数据快处理、可靠的系统,因此在硬件和软件上都有很大的要求,因此在这里进行了多方面的考虑有以下两个实现方案: 方案一:利用STM32单片机作为手持终端的控制器,使用按键和12864液晶屏作为人机交互的接口。利用51单片机作为房子内部的电灯、空调、门禁等家电的控制器,利用...
分类:系统相关   时间:2015-07-24 22:41:52    阅读次数:231
Linux 多学习过程
1Linux流程概述过程是,一旦运行过程中的程序,他和程序本质上的区别。程序是静态的,他奉命收集指令存储在磁盘上。进程是动态的概念。他是执行者的程序,包括进程的动态创建。调度和消亡,是Linux的基本调度单位。进程控制块(PCB)是进程的静态描写叙述,包含进程的描写叙述信息。进程的控制信息,以及资源...
分类:系统相关   时间:2015-07-24 22:34:15    阅读次数:164
linux内核源码注解
轻松学习Linux操作系统内核源码的方法 针对好多Linux 爱好者对内核很有兴趣却无从下口,本文旨在介绍一种解读linux内核源码的入门方法,而不是解说linux复杂的内核机制;一.核心源程序的文件组织:1.Linux核心源程序通常都安装在/usr/src/linux下,而且它有一个非常简单的编号...
分类:系统相关   时间:2015-07-24 22:21:58    阅读次数:176
Linux Kernel系列 - 黄牛X内核代码凝视
Hanks.Wang - 专注于操作系统与移动安全研究。Linux-Kernel/SELinux/SEAndroid/TrustZone/Encription/MDM Mail -byhankswang@gmail.com牛X的内核代码凝视大牛的代码质量高稳定性好,并且逻辑清晰易读性比較强,今天看....
分类:系统相关   时间:2015-07-24 22:21:19    阅读次数:220
MyEclipse常见错误汇总,中英注释版(长期更新)
在使用MyEclips的过程中会出现各种各样的错误,以此记录,便于日后查阅
分类:系统相关   时间:2015-07-24 22:22:12    阅读次数:168
《linux内核设计与实现》阅读笔记
第二章 内核开发的特点: 1内核编程时既不能访问C库,也不能访问标准的C头文件。 2内核编程时必须使用GNU C。 3内核编程时缺乏像用户空间那样的内存保护机制。 4内核编程时难以执行浮点计算。 5内核给每个进程只有一个很小的定长堆栈。 6由于内核支持异步中断、抢占和SMP,...
分类:系统相关   时间:2015-07-24 22:18:50    阅读次数:164
Linux内核学习方法
Makefile不是Make Love 从前在学校,混了四年,没有学到任何东西,每天就是逃课,上网,玩游戏,睡觉。毕业的时候,人家跟我说Makefile我完全不知,但是一说Make Love我就来劲了,现在想来依然觉得丢人。 毫不夸张地说,Kconfig和Makefile是我们浏览内核代码时最为依仗...
分类:系统相关   时间:2015-07-24 22:06:02    阅读次数:147
Ubuntu 1204 升级到 1404
sudo apt-get update sudo apt-get dist-upgrade update-manager -d中途会询问是否替换配置文件等,根据个人需求选择吧...
分类:系统相关   时间:2015-07-24 20:54:02    阅读次数:146
无Maven不项目---使用Eclipse快速搭建Maven项目
自从了解Maven和会使用Maven之后,无论创建什么类型的工程,java,web我都会使用Maven来管理项目,就是因为它提供的依赖功能,说白了就是你想用到什么包就去Maven仓库搜索,并将坐标粘贴在pom.xml中,保存一下, Eclipse就会自动为你下载相关的包,省了导出找jar包的时间,和版本冲突的问题!下面使用Eclipse快速搭建Maven项目 如果你的Eclipse自带Maven那...
分类:系统相关   时间:2015-07-24 20:51:58    阅读次数:234
Linux文件系统管理
Linux文件系统管理 |-文件系统构成 |-设备挂载 |-分区和格式化原理 |-磁盘配额 |-系统备份一、文件系统构成※ /usr/bin、/bin:存放所有用户可以执行的命令※ /usr/sbin、/sbin:存放只有root可以执行的命令※ /home:用户缺省宿主目录※ /proc:虚拟文件...
分类:系统相关   时间:2015-07-24 20:41:55    阅读次数:226
Linux tr命令
kuang:~$ tr --helpUsage: tr [OPTION]... SET1 [SET2]Translate, squeeze, and/or delete characters from standard input,writing to standard output. -c, -....
分类:系统相关   时间:2015-07-24 20:35:23    阅读次数:173
【转】Linux命令大全
系统信息arch 显示机器的处理器架构(1)uname -m 显示机器的处理器架构(2)uname -r 显示正在使用的内核版本dmidecode -q 显示硬件系统部件 - (SMBIOS / DMI)hdparm -i /dev/hda 罗列一个磁盘的架构特性hdparm -tT /dev/sd...
分类:系统相关   时间:2015-07-24 20:29:28    阅读次数:197
cmd 打开gitshell
C:\Users\Username\AppData\Local\GitHub\GitHub.appref-ms --open-shell
分类:系统相关   时间:2015-07-24 20:22:41    阅读次数:168
Linux 系统挂载数据盘
适用系统:Linux(Redhat , CentOS,Debian,Ubuntu)* Linux的云服务器数据盘未做分区和格式化,可以根据以下步骤进行分区以及格式化操作。下面的操作将会把数据盘划分为一个分区来使用。1、查看数据盘。在没有分区和格式化数据盘之前,使用 “df -h”命令,是无法看到数据...
分类:系统相关   时间:2015-07-24 20:17:01    阅读次数:152
Linux下压缩某个文件夹(文件夹打包)
tar -zcvf /home/xahot.tar.gz /xahottar -zcvf 打包后生成的文件名全路径 要打包的目录例子:把/xahot文件夹打包后生成一个/home/xahot.tar.gz的文件。zip 压缩方法:压缩当前的文件夹 zip -r ./xahot.zip ./* -r表...
分类:系统相关   时间:2015-07-24 20:15:12    阅读次数:140
Linux目录介绍
/: 根目录,一般根目录下只存放目录,不要存放文件,/etc、/bin、/dev、/lib、/sbin应该和根目录放置在一个分区中/bin:/usr/bin: 可执行二进制文件的目录,如常用的命令ls、tar、mv、cat等。/boot: 放置linux系统启动时用到的一些文件。/boot/vmli...
分类:系统相关   时间:2015-07-24 20:12:30    阅读次数:210
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!